Unfortunately, the Wellesley location closed due to βhigh rent,β is what staff said to me. They may reopen somewhere else, perhaps Needham, but that is just a guess, at this time. Other locations remain
OPEN , eg in Newton Center.
I have been eating at this restaurant for more decades than I care to found. Awhile ago, there were some problems with some of the staff who were sometimes rude to you if you complained about a problem you had with the food. That there were any problems with the food was, itself, an unfortunate development.
I cannot report the exact dates, but the restaurant changed hands and now many of the previous staff members are back and they are as friendly as they had always been. The quality of the food is once again back to its high standards. And, I still frequent Amarins in Wellesley, one of my most favorite restaurants!

Excellent Thai restaurant with large rooms and informal atmosphere. I bought the food from their site and picked it up to take away: Good food and very generous portions. Clean environment and very friendly staff. Very extensive menu with a wide choice of meat and fish dishes. However, without dessert, very little choice. Average price. Advised.
